Output dfd3cd37e356fcc8e6468606632445c2dca78a542a982c4110bf7d7fe8e89cbb:0

value
104500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0595177e6f5f6b63bfc57a21bf79c90d6bad631d OP_EQUAL
address
32CXuaeQK9uju49LZwty3JHLp1Fku7LD2d
transaction
dfd3cd37e356fcc8e6468606632445c2dca78a542a982c4110bf7d7fe8e89cbb
confirmations
258938
spent
true